Sleepless nights have become somewhat of an epidemic in recent times. With technology at our fingertips and work demands increasing, it’s easy to find ourselves lying in bed, tossing and turning, unable to shut off our racing minds. However, the consequences of sleep deprivation go far beyond feeling groggy or irritable the next day.

Sleep is essential for our bodies and minds to function optimally. During sleep, our body repairs damaged cells, strengthens our immune system, and consolidates memories. Moreover, lack of sleep has been linked to various health issues, such as obesity, heart disease, diabetes, and depression. So, the importance of finding a way to overcome sleepless nights cannot be stressed enough.

To improve sleep quality, establishing healthy sleep habits, also known as sleep hygiene, is crucial. This includes maintaining a consistent sleep schedule, creating a relaxing pre-sleep routine, keeping the bedroom environment conducive to sleep (cool, dark, and quiet), and avoiding stimulants like caffeine or electronic devices before bed.
